The science of inside out july 3, 2015 nytimes website by dacher keltner and paul ekman five years ago, the writer and director pete docter of pixar reached out to us to talk over an idea for a film, one that would portray how emotions work inside a persons head and at the same time shape a persons outer life with other people. Jun 14, 2017 a conversation with the psychologist behind inside out emotions expert dacher keltner, who advised director pete docter throughout the making of the new pixar hit, dives deep into the science of emotion, and tells us how inside out could teach western culture an important lesson. Inside out is about how five emotions personified as the characters anger, disgust, fear, sadness and joy grapple for control of the mind of an 11yearold girl named riley during the tumult of a move from minnesota to san francisco.
